Good stuff for sentimentalists
23 November 2003
"Music From Another Room" is a romantic comedy with the sweetly sentimental flavor of a Hallmark or Disney production mixed with the occasional reality check to keep the goo from getting too thick. Sporting a fine cast, this dreamy film about a motley family and birth and death and love offers a fun scene to scene linear flow, keeps the sentimentality in check, builds its predictable love story, and manages several subplots all the while holding interest and easing a somewhat difficult buy-in resulting in a good all around romantic flick. Not for cynics, "Music From Another Room" will play best with sentimentalists. (B)
